Bu y\u00fczden, <a href=\"https:\/\/www.fundomundo.com\/tr-tr\/bilim\">\u00e7ocuklar i\u00e7in bilim e\u011fitimi<\/a>ne erken ya\u015fta ba\u015flanmas\u0131 \u00f6neriliyor.\u00a0<\/p>\n\n\n\n<h2 id=\"j1407b-ote-uydu-ve-saturn-uzerinde-steroid\">J1407b &#8211; \u00d6te uydu ve Sat\u00fcrn \u00fczerinde steroid<\/h2>\n\n\n\n<p>Sat\u00fcrn&#8217;\u00fcn halkalar\u0131n\u0131 1600&#8217;lerde teleskoplar icat edildi\u011finden beri biliyoruz, ancak daha fazlas\u0131n\u0131 ortaya \u00e7\u0131karmak i\u00e7in son 50 y\u0131lda in\u015fa edilen uzay ara\u00e7lar\u0131 ve daha g\u00fc\u00e7l\u00fc teleskoplar gerekti. G\u00fcne\u015f sistemimizden yakla\u015f\u0131k 400 \u0131\u015f\u0131k y\u0131l\u0131 uzakta, Sat\u00fcrn&#8217;\u00fcn steroidlerine benzeyen bir g\u00f6k cismi var. Asl\u0131nda halka sistemi o kadar b\u00fcy\u00fck ki, bilim insanlar\u0131 y\u00f6r\u00fcngesinde d\u00f6nd\u00fc\u011f\u00fc y\u0131ld\u0131z\u0131n \u00e7ekim g\u00fcc\u00fcyle neden par\u00e7alanmad\u0131\u011f\u0131ndan emin de\u011filler. Halkalar gezegenden gezegene farkl\u0131l\u0131k g\u00f6steriyor: Sat\u00fcrn&#8217;\u00fcn k\u0131smen \u0131\u015f\u0131lt\u0131l\u0131, yans\u0131t\u0131c\u0131 su buzundan olu\u015fan muhte\u015fem halesi ba\u015fka hi\u00e7bir yerde tekrarlanm\u0131yor. Bunun yerine, di\u011fer gezegenlerin halkalar\u0131 muhtemelen kayal\u0131k par\u00e7ac\u0131klar ve tozdan olu\u015fuyor. Halkalar\u0131n bozulmadan kalabilmesinin bir nedeni, merkezlerindeki J1407b ad\u0131 verilen nesnenin etraf\u0131nda d\u00f6nd\u00fckleri y\u00f6nle ilgilidir. Bilim insanlar\u0131 J1407b&#8217;nin Sat\u00fcrn&#8217;den kat kat b\u00fcy\u00fck devasa bir gezegen mi yoksa kahverengi c\u00fcce ad\u0131 verilen ba\u015far\u0131s\u0131z bir y\u0131ld\u0131z m\u0131 oldu\u011fundan emin de\u011filler. J1407b&#8217;nin orant\u0131s\u0131z y\u00f6r\u00fcngesinde, g\u00fcne\u015f benzeri y\u0131ld\u0131z\u0131na yakla\u015ft\u0131\u011f\u0131nda halkalar\u0131 bozmas\u0131 gereken bir nokta var. Halkalar \u00e7o\u011funlukla zarar g\u00f6rmeden kal\u0131yor \u00e7\u00fcnk\u00fc J1407b&#8217;nin etraf\u0131nda, nesnenin y\u0131ld\u0131z\u0131n\u0131n etraf\u0131nda d\u00f6nd\u00fc\u011f\u00fc y\u00f6n\u00fcn tersine d\u00f6n\u00fcyorlar. Bu da y\u0131ld\u0131z\u0131n yo\u011fun yer\u00e7ekimi kar\u015f\u0131s\u0131nda bir halka formasyonu i\u00e7inde bir arada kalabilecekleri anlam\u0131na geliyor.&nbsp;<\/p>\n\n\n\n<h2 id=\"gj-1214b-su-dunyasi\">Gj 1214b &#8211; Su D\u00fcnyas\u0131<\/h2>\n\n\n\n<p>Bilim insanlar\u0131 D\u00fcnya&#8217;dan daha b\u00fcy\u00fck, ancak Uran\u00fcs&#8217;ten daha k\u00fc\u00e7\u00fck olan buharl\u0131 bir su d\u00fcnyas\u0131 ke\u015ffettiler. Bu yeni \u00f6tegezegen s\u0131n\u0131f\u0131n\u0131n standart ta\u015f\u0131y\u0131c\u0131s\u0131, g\u00f6kbilimcilerin ilk kez Aral\u0131k 2009&#8217;da ke\u015ffetti\u011fi GJ 1214b olarak adland\u0131r\u0131l\u0131yor. NASA&#8217;n\u0131n Hubble Uzay Teleskobu taraf\u0131ndan yap\u0131lan yeni g\u00f6zlemler, GJ 1214b&#8217;nin kal\u0131n, buharl\u0131 bir atmosfer taraf\u0131ndan \u00f6rt\u00fclm\u00fc\u015f oldu\u011funu ortaya koydu. Gezegenin b\u00fcy\u00fck bir b\u00f6l\u00fcm\u00fc sudan olu\u015fuyor. Ophiuchus (Y\u0131lan Ta\u015f\u0131y\u0131c\u0131) tak\u0131my\u0131ld\u0131z\u0131nda D\u00fcnya&#8217;dan 40 \u0131\u015f\u0131k y\u0131l\u0131 uzakl\u0131kta bulunan GJ 1214b&#8217;nin tamamen yeni bir gezegen oldu\u011fu ke\u015ffedildi. &#8220;S\u00fcper-D\u00fcnya&#8221; olarak adland\u0131r\u0131lan bu gezegenin \u00e7ap\u0131 D\u00fcnya&#8217;n\u0131n yakla\u015f\u0131k 2,7 kat\u0131d\u0131r ve a\u011f\u0131rl\u0131\u011f\u0131 bizim gezegenimizin yakla\u015f\u0131k yedi kat\u0131d\u0131r. K\u0131rm\u0131z\u0131 c\u00fcce bir y\u0131ld\u0131z\u0131n y\u00f6r\u00fcngesinde 2 milyon kilometre mesafede d\u00f6n\u00fcyor ve tahmini y\u00fczey s\u0131cakl\u0131\u011f\u0131 230 santigrat derece olarak \u00f6l\u00e7\u00fcl\u00fcyor. Ya\u015fam formunu bar\u0131nd\u0131ramayacak kadar s\u0131cak. D\u00fcnya&#8217;dan \u00e7ok daha fazla suya ve \u00e7ok daha az kayaya sahip gibi g\u00f6r\u00fcnmektedir. Yabanc\u0131 gezegenin i\u00e7 yap\u0131s\u0131 muhtemelen d\u00fcnyam\u0131z\u0131nkinden olduk\u00e7a farkl\u0131d\u0131r. GJ 1214b D\u00fcnya&#8217;ya \u00e7ok yak\u0131n oldu\u011fu i\u00e7in gelecekteki ara\u00e7lar taraf\u0131ndan incelenmek \u00fczere birincil adayd\u0131r.<\/p>\n\n\n\n<h2 id=\"gliese-436b-fizik-kurallarina-uymayan-gezegen\">Gliese 436b &#8211; Fizik Kurallar\u0131na Uymayan Gezegen<\/h2>\n\n\n\n<p>Genellikle buz denince akl\u0131m\u0131za donmu\u015f bir k\u00fcp gelir. Peki ya buz neredeyse 537 santigrat derece olsayd\u0131? D\u00fc\u015f\u00fcnmesi bile tuhaf, de\u011fil mi?&nbsp; \u015ea\u015f\u0131rt\u0131c\u0131 bir \u015fekilde, Gliese 436 b d\u0131\u015f gezegeni tam olarak buna sahip.<\/p>\n\n\n\n<p>Gliese 436 b, D\u00fcnya&#8217;dan yakla\u015f\u0131k 33 \u0131\u015f\u0131k y\u0131l\u0131 uzakl\u0131kta, bilinen en yak\u0131n \u00f6tegezegenlerden biridir. Bu \u00f6tegezegen yakla\u015f\u0131k Nept\u00fcn b\u00fcy\u00fckl\u00fc\u011f\u00fcnde ve kendi y\u0131ld\u0131z\u0131 olan Gliese 436&#8217;dan sadece 2,5 milyon mil uzakta. Referans olarak, Merk\u00fcr&#8217;\u00fcn G\u00fcne\u015f&#8217;ten uzakl\u0131\u011f\u0131 35 milyon mil gibi \u015fa\u015f\u0131rt\u0131c\u0131 bir mesafedir.&nbsp;<\/p>\n\n\n\n<p>Gliese 436 b&#8217;nin bile\u015fiminin b\u00fcy\u00fck bir k\u0131sm\u0131 bilinmemektedir, ancak bilim insanlar\u0131 \u00e7o\u011funlukla hidrojenden olu\u015fan bir atmosfere sahip b\u00fcy\u00fck miktarda su ile \u00e7evrili D\u00fcnya benzeri bir \u00e7ekirdek ke\u015ffetmi\u015flerdir.<\/p>\n\n\n\n<p>Esasen, Gliese 436 b bir y\u0131ld\u0131z\u0131n hemen yan\u0131nda konumlanm\u0131\u015f devasa bir gezegendir. Tipik olarak, d\u0131\u015f gezegen bir y\u0131ld\u0131za \u00e7ok yak\u0131n oldu\u011fu i\u00e7in atmosferin \u00e7\u00f6z\u00fclece\u011fi ve herhangi bir suyun uzaya buharla\u015faca\u011f\u0131 d\u00fc\u015f\u00fcn\u00fclebilir.&nbsp; Merk\u00fcr gibi daha k\u00fc\u00e7\u00fck gezegenlerde bu do\u011frudur.&nbsp; Ancak, Gliese 436 b Nept\u00fcn b\u00fcy\u00fckl\u00fc\u011f\u00fcndedir, bu nedenle \u00e7ekim alan\u0131 o kadar b\u00fcy\u00fckt\u00fcr ki sadece bir atmosferi korumakla kalmaz, ayn\u0131 zamanda y\u00fczeyindeki suyu kat\u0131 bir duruma s\u0131k\u0131\u015ft\u0131r\u0131r.&nbsp; Bu da suyun buz benzeri bir halde kalmas\u0131na ve ayn\u0131 zamanda ana y\u0131ld\u0131z olan Gliese 436&#8217;ya yak\u0131nl\u0131\u011f\u0131ndan dolay\u0131 a\u015f\u0131r\u0131 s\u0131cakl\u0131klara ula\u015fmas\u0131na neden olur. Ancak Gliese 436 b&#8217;nin y\u00fczeyindeki buz normal buz de\u011fildir.&nbsp; S\u0131cakl\u0131k nedeniyle kat\u0131 hale ge\u00e7en D\u00fcnya&#8217;daki buzun aksine, Gliese 436 b&#8217;deki buz sadece bas\u0131n\u00e7 nedeniyle kat\u0131 haldedir. Sonu\u00e7ta, gezegenin y\u00fczeyi 537 santigrat dereceye yak\u0131nd\u0131r. Her ne kadar \u00e7\u0131lg\u0131nca g\u00f6r\u00fcnse de bu durum, suyun yeterli bas\u0131nca maruz kalmas\u0131 halinde, D\u00fcnya&#8217;da var olmayan tamamen yeni bir forma b\u00fcr\u00fcnebilece\u011fini g\u00f6stermektedir.<\/p>\n\n\n\n<h2 id=\"gj-504b-pembe-gezegen\">Gj-504b &#8211; Pembe Gezegen<\/h2>\n\n\n\n<p>Simsiyah bir evrende pembe bir gezegen hayal eder miydiniz? E\u011fer bu dev gezegene seyahat edebilseydik, koyu kiraz \u00e7i\u00e7e\u011fini and\u0131ran donuk bir eflatun rengiyle, olu\u015fumunun s\u0131cakl\u0131\u011f\u0131ndan hala parlayan bir d\u00fcnya g\u00f6r\u00fcrd\u00fck. GJ 504b olarak adland\u0131r\u0131lan gezegen pembe gazdan olu\u015fuyor. Kendi g\u00fcne\u015f sistemimizdeki dev bir gaz gezegeni olan J\u00fcpiter&#8217;e benziyor. GJ 504b, J\u00fcpiter&#8217;den yakla\u015f\u0131k d\u00f6rt kat daha b\u00fcy\u00fckt\u00fcr ve yakla\u015f\u0131k 237 santigrat dereceye sahiptir. G\u00fcne\u015f&#8217;ten biraz daha s\u0131cak olan ve Ba\u015fak tak\u0131my\u0131ld\u0131z\u0131nda \u00e7\u0131plak g\u00f6zle zay\u0131f bir \u015fekilde g\u00f6r\u00fclebilen G0 tipi y\u0131ld\u0131z GJ 504&#8217;\u00fcn y\u00f6r\u00fcngesinde d\u00f6nmektedir. Y\u0131ld\u0131z 57 \u0131\u015f\u0131k y\u0131l\u0131 uzakl\u0131kta yer al\u0131yor ve ara\u015ft\u0131rmac\u0131lar y\u0131ld\u0131z\u0131n rengini ve d\u00f6n\u00fc\u015f periyodunu ya\u015f\u0131yla ili\u015fkilendiren y\u00f6ntemlere dayanarak sistemin yakla\u015f\u0131k 160 milyon ya\u015f\u0131nda oldu\u011funu tahmin ediyor.<\/p>\n\n\n\n<h2 id=\"wasp-12b-isigi-yutan-gezegen\">WASP-12b &#8211; I\u015f\u0131\u011f\u0131 Yutan Gezegen<\/h2>\n\n\n\n<p>G\u00fcne\u015fin eksenini 1,1 g\u00fcnde d\u00f6nen bir gezegen d\u00fc\u015f\u00fcn\u00fcn. 10 milyon y\u0131l i\u00e7inde bu yabanc\u0131 gezegen tamamen s\u00f6nebilir. J\u00fcpiter&#8217;imizin neredeyse iki kat\u0131 b\u00fcy\u00fckl\u00fc\u011f\u00fcndeki WASP-12b, s\u0131cakl\u0131\u011f\u0131 yakla\u015f\u0131k 2.210 santigrat derece olan c\u0131z\u0131rt\u0131l\u0131 bir gaz devidir. Yer\u00e7ekimi, gezegeni bir yumurta \u015feklinde gerdiren muazzam gelgit kuvvetlerine neden olmaktad\u0131r. WASP-12b, Auriga tak\u0131my\u0131ld\u0131z\u0131nda yakla\u015f\u0131k 1.200 \u0131\u015f\u0131k y\u0131l\u0131 uzakl\u0131kta yer almaktad\u0131r. J\u00fcpiter&#8217;in yar\u0131\u00e7ap\u0131n\u0131n 1,8 kat\u0131 ve J\u00fcpiter&#8217;in k\u00fctlesinin 1,4 kat\u0131d\u0131r.<\/p>\n","protected":false},"excerpt":{"rendered":"<p>\u00c7ocuklar i\u00e7in do\u011fa ve yery\u00fcz\u00fc e\u011fitiminin \u00f6nemi her ge\u00e7en g\u00fcn art\u0131yor.
